Tehran, June 27, IRNA The Central Bank of Iran has put the inflation rate for the 12-month period ended the third Iranian calendar month of Khordad (May 22-June 21) at 15.6 percent.
The consumer price index (CPI) in Irans urban areas was 225.5 in the month of Khordad, a 1.7 percent decrease compared with the preceding calendar month.
The CPI measures changes in the price level of a market basket of consumer goods and services purchased by households. It is a statistical estimate constructed using the prices of a sample of representative items whose prices are collected periodically.
Meanwhile, the Statistical Center of Iran on Wednesday put the inflation rate at 14.2 percent.
In July 2014, Finance and Economic Affairs Minister Ali Tayebnia said the Iranian government will implement anti-recession programs until a single-digit inflation rate is achieved.
The administration has prepared a comprehensive plan to combat high inflation and bring the national economy out of recession, Tayebnia added.
